### Step 2: Port the relevance tuning notes

Heads up, reviewer: the old Searchlark tuning notes lived in a wiki export, but we're moving boost weights and synonym overrides into the `tuning_params` table so they're versioned alongside deploys. Run the import script with `--validate` first — it'll flag any weights outside the 0–10 range that the old wiki happily allowed. Once validation passes, point the importer at the staging database via the connection string below.

primary connection of yagep-kahip = redis://giliel_svc:zYiKsLL2PLpfPL@db-348f.xolmarsys.corp:5432/fenwyn

### 2.8.1 — Key Rotation

Rotated the signing key used for Gridmarsh admin-table bulk-edit releases after the old key passed its expiry window. All bulk-op artifacts from this version onward are signed with the new key; older packages remain verifiable against the archived key in the vault. Update your verification config before pulling 2.8.1 or later. New release signing key:

release key, kahif-yagap: bky3_1JN

Each environment has its own queue shard count and candidate-timeout rules, so don't copy settings blindly between them. Staging intentionally uses shorter timeouts to surface flaky handoffs early.

If you're onboarding, skim the intake worker docs first. The current staging configuration values are listed below.

service settings:
[pelius]
port = 5432
team = praius
host = pelius.crelvoforge.internal
region = upper-4
access_code = ac_8f224d
timeout_ms = 2000

**14:22** — Kiosk units at the Bramleyfield lobby started reboot-looping. Turns out the Dovetail watchdog was pinging the old health endpoint we deprecated in last week's refactor, got three timeouts, and dutifully power-cycled everything. Classic case of the watchdog being more reliable than the thing it watches. Marta hotfixed the endpoint path at 14:41 and loops stopped by 14:45. Reviewer note: the fix is two lines, but please sanity-check the retry backoff too. Affected build token follows below.

build token for yajof-bajof: htk31_506ff1188f74596b5bb2eec94edc43c